Nvidia boss presses G20 ministers to build AI infrastructure

Chapel Hill: Nvidia chief Jensen Huang urged G20 ministers on Wednesday to build more data centers to support the artificial intelligence revolution, and warned that leaders who talk up the technology’s dangers risk leaving their countries behind.

Huang made the plea on the second day of a G20 meeting in North Carolina, where the Trump administration has corralled top AI executives to pitch their vision to ministers from the world’s leading economies.
